An Affordable Fragrance that Completes the Turn?
I purchased 360° Red on a whim, because it is near the end of Winter in New York City, and as the seasons change, I wanted something for warmer weather.

----

360° Red is a light fragrance that smells like a combination of fresh and citrus notes like lavender, orange, and lime. Admittedly, the smell reminds me of Giorgio Armani’s Acqua di Giò pour Homme Eau de Toilette .

Unfortunately, this also means that 360° Red struggles to stand out from the crowd. In addition to the original Acqua di Gio, there are many fragrances with similar profiles. However, I will say that 360° Red is spicier, albeit the spices are very subtle.

----

360° Red has the typical performance of fresh or citrus Eau de Toilettes made for warm weather and tropical climates.

Sillage and projection are average. People may not notice the fragrance as you pass them, but it will not announce your presence when you enter a room. This makes 360° Red versatile enough to wear in an office environment, or at the gym.

On the negative side, a typical warm-weather fresh or citrus EdT also means that longevity is a weak point. Expect 360° Red to last about 4 hours before needing to apply it again.

----

The biggest critique I have overall is the bottle. Normally, I do not care about bottle design unless it is notable or a design flaw.

Here, it is notable that 360° Red (and the entire 360° line) looks like a combination of a small water bottle and a woman’s vibrator. However, outside of the easy sex jokes, the fragrance is affordable at less than $30 USD for a 100 ml bottle.

----

Overall, Perry Ellis 360° Red for Men is a solid fragrance and knows the audience it is trying to seek.

If someone wants a unique summer fragrance to stand out from the crowd, 360° Red is a waste of time, and they should look elsewhere.

However, if someone is seeking a masculine, fresh, and citrus fragrance at an affordable price for the warmer months or a warm climate, 360° Red will probably complete the circle.

my favorite citrus perfume
An extraordinary scent! Similar to ADG but better. And this is what I call it, of course, stimulated by the price of it. And the smell is more special not being as aquatic or floral as ADG.
Negative: bottle! The rest is close to the maximum mark.
I recommend moisturizing the skin before applying it: I get to projection for over 2 hours and longevity to the skin all day at the office.
For those who look for fragrances of up to 20-40 euros and do not go into the analysis of synthetic natural components (and other "connoisseur") I consider it a great option for having a citrus perfume.

Lost cost, basic scent
Nice, low cost masculine fragrance that would work well for warmer days and nights in spring, summer and fall. Too weak to use in winter. Moderate projection for the first hour or so, but stays close to the body for a surprisingly long amount of time. For me, about 7 to 8 hours.

After the initial citrus blast and once it's settled down, I'd describe it as a clean scent, less as a fresh scent. Scent reminds me (not same as) the clothing section of a department store - clean, newly manufactured clothing with a subtle touch of cinnamon. Great blind buy for me and will use for warmer weather.

Atomizer is not the best. Bottle is inconvenient due to its height.

Affordable Acqua di Gio Variant
I came across this fragrance through numerous videos by the YouTuber Jeremy Fragrance. I really enjoy watching his videos and top lists, as they come across as truly authentic and honest. The fact that even very affordable fragrances are included convinces me of his credibility.
Affordable doesn’t always mean inferior. This scent is a beautiful example of that. Acqua di Gio is, for me, one of the greatest fragrance classics in the men’s category. Pretty much everyone should know it and have smelled it many times. I used to wear it often as well. Now, however, I feel like I’ve outgrown it and don’t want to smell it on myself anymore.
360 Red goes pretty much in this direction. The indicated fragrance twin is correct, yet it’s not a clone of it. Whether that was intentional? Who knows. Nevertheless, it also has its own characteristics alongside the ADG vibe. I find 360 a bit woodier and sweeter. This concept feels like an update to the rather overused classic. It has significantly more power and dynamism. Additionally, it has a nice spiciness. I like it better than ADG.
The performance is also top-notch. Although it’s not very evident in the comments here. On me, it lasts at least 8 hours. The sillage is also quite decent and similar to ADG. Amazing, considering you can get 360 Red for just 40 euros (200ml!). For budget-conscious folks who don’t place value on well-known names, it’s really a must to test this one.
The bottle is also truly eye-catching. It looks really elegant and stands tall. The hype around this twin is definitely justified. I even like it better.

A small addendum: I also bought the deodorant of this fragrance. 2x200ml for 15 euros. I can only highly recommend it. It’s inexpensive compared to many deodorant sprays from other manufacturers. Very pleasant and fresh.
